Report and recornimendation 'of Dick Sanders, Commissioner of
Finance and Revenue t - r-e- _�.salc of Fire Apparatus, Bonds, as follo,• +s.
San Luis Obispo, June 12th. 1916.
To the I,iayor and City Co-ancil :-
The matter of the settlement for
Firc Apparatus left to me for report and to outline a plan of payment
for same, I beg to suggest the following:
� V
_ First that the City Council create a "Sinking Fund" to be
known as the "rater Sinking Fund ".
Second, that they transfer from
the "W ter Fund" to the "L;at-
er Sinking Fand" the sum of P" 10,300.00
Third, that they transfer from the "',Dater Sink: ng Fund" to
the "General PUnd" the sum of r 10,300.00
Fourth, that they then authorize the issuance of a ,,arrant
on the " General ^und" in the sum of tiY95B0.00, in favor of the Sea-
grave Company, to pay for the Fire Engine as per contract ,-:ith the
:ea,rave Company.
Fifth, that the balance be left in the "General Fund" to
apply on fire hose and other accessories for the Fire DePartment.
I also recommend that to secure the "i ater Sin1:ing Fund "that
the Bonds authorized b$ the Bond Election for Fire :.pparattis, be is-
sued 1
' and placed in said Fund.
Yours Respectfully,
Dick Sanders,
Commissioner of Finance and Revenue.
